Cookshire-Eaton, Quebec, Canada

Overview

Cookshire-Eaton is a small, scenic town set in the Estrie region of Quebec, known for its rural charm, historic sites, and friendly community. It offers a tranquil environment, making it ideal for relaxing getaways and outdoor activities.

Best Time to Visit

June-September for pleasant summer weather and local festivals.

Local Tips

A car is helpful for exploring the picturesque countryside and nearby attractions, as public transportation is limited. Most businesses close early, so plan meals and shopping accordingly.

Cultural Etiquette

French is widely spoken; a friendly 'Bonjour' goes a long way. Tipping in restaurants is standard at 15%. Casual, modest dress is appropriate, especially in rural settings.

Safety Warnings

Cookshire-Eaton is very safe with low crime rates. Exercise standard caution at night in less-populated areas. Watch for wildlife when driving on rural roads.

Hidden Gems

Visit the Eaton Corner Museum for local history, and explore the Johnville Bog & Forest Park for unique walking trails and birdwatching opportunities.
